Abstract
As grid technology matures the number of production grids dynamically increases. The management and the optimal utilization of these grid resources cannot be handled by the users themselves. To hide the lower level details of grid access, grid portals have been developed. Unfortunately, today’s grid portals are typically tightly coupled to one specific grid environment and do not provide multi-grid support. The P-GRADE Portal is a workflow-oriented multi-grid portal with the main goal to support all stages of grid workflow development and execution processes. One very important aspect of utilizing multiple grids within one complex scientific workflow is to interact with multiple and potentially different grid brokers supported by the different grids. This paper describes how the portal was interfaced to grid brokers to reach resources of different grids in an automated way. This way a workflow can be brokered over several grids based on different underlying technologies but still providing optimal utilization of resources. To ease the addition and usage of different resource brokers, we introduce a meta-brokering concept. With this new grid middleware component portal users can utilize a growing number of grids for highly computation intensive applications in the future.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
G. Allen et al., “Enabling Applications on the Grid: A GridLab Overview”, International Journal of High Performance Computing Applications, Issue 17, 2003, {pp. 449-466}.
J. Cao, S. A. Jarvis, S. Saini, and G. R. Nudd, “GridFlow: WorkFlow Management for Grid Computing”, In Proc. of the 3rd IEEE/ACM International Symposium on Cluster Computing and the Grid (CCGRID’03), 2003, {pp. 198-205}.
Z. Farkas, Z. Balaton and P. Kacsuk, “Supporting MPI Applications in P-GRADE Portal”, in Proceedings of the 6th Austrian-Hungarian Workshop on Distributed and Parallel Systems (DAPSYS), Innsbruck (Austria), 2007, pp. 55-64.
I. Foster and C. Kesselman, “The Globus Project: A Status Report”, in Proc. of the Seventh Heterogeneous Computing Workshop, IEEE Computer Society Press, Orlando, Florida, USA, 1998, {pp. 4-18}.
Job Submission Description Language (JSDL):http://www.ggf.org/documents/GFD.56.pdf
P. Kacsuk and G. Sipos, “Multi-Grid, Multi-User Workflows in the P-GRADE Grid Portal”, Journal of Grid Computing, Vol. 3, No 3-4, 2005, {pp. 221-238}.
P. Kacsuk, G. Sipos, A. Tóth, Z. Farkas, G. Kecskeméti and and G. Hermann, “Defining and Running Parametric Study Workflow Applications by the P-GRADE Portal”, Krakow Grid Workshop, 2006
A. Kertész, “Brokering Solutions for Grid Middlewares”, in Pre-proc. of 1st Doctoral Workshop on Mathematical and Engineering Methods in Computer Science, 2005.
A. Kertész and P. Kacsuk, “A Taxonomy of Grid Resource Brokers”, 6th Austrian-Hungarian Workshop on Distributed and Parallel Systems (DAPSYS), Innsbruck, Austria, 2006.
A. Kertesz, I. Rodero, and F. Guim, “BPDL: A Data Model for Grid Resource Broker Capabilities”, CoreGrid Technical Report no. 74, 2007
LCG-2 User Guide, 4 August, 2005: http://www.edms.cern.ch/file/454439/2/LCG-2-UserGuide.html, gLite Middleware: http://glite.web.cern.ch/glite/
F. Neubauer, A. Hoheisel, and J. Geiler, “Workflow-based Grid Applications”, Future Generation Computer Systems, Volume 22, Issues 1-2, January 2006, {pp. 6-15}.
NorduGrid Middleware: http://www.nordugrid.org/middleware/
Open Science Grid: http://www.opensciencegrid.org/
P-GRADE GIN VO Portal: http://www.gin-portal.cpc.wmin.ac.uk:8080/gridsphere
P-GRADE Grid Portal: http://www.lpds.sztaki.hu/pgportal
G. Singh et al, “The Pegasus Portal: Web Based Grid Computing” In Proc. of 20th Annual ACM Symposium on Applied Computing, Santa Fe, New Mexico, 2005.
Southern Eastern European GRid-enabled eInfrastructure Development (SEE-GRID): http://www.see-grid.org/
D. Thain, T. Tannenbaum, and M. Livny, “Distributed Computing in Practice: The Condor Experience”, Concurrency and Computation: Practice and Experience, 2005, {pp. 323-356}.
The HunGrid Virtual Organisation: http://www.lcg.kfki.hu/?hungrid
The Swiss Grid Initiative: http://www.swiss-grid.org/index.html
TeraGrid: http://www.teragrid.org/
UK e-Science OGSA Testbed: http://www.dsg.port.ac.uk/projects/ogsa-testbed/
UK National Grid Service: http://www.ngs.ac.uk/
Virtual Organisation for Central Europe (VOCE): http://egee.cesnet.cz/en/voce/
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2009 Springer Science+Business Media, LLC
About this paper
Cite this paper
Kertész, A., Farkas, Z., Kacsuk, P., Kiss, T. (2009). Grid Interoperability by Multiple Broker Utilization and Meta-Broking. In: Davoli, F., Meyer, N., Pugliese, R., Zappatore, S. (eds) Grid Enabled Remote Instrumentation. Signals and Communication Technology. Springer, New York, NY. https://doi.org/10.1007/978-0-387-09663-6_20
Download citation
DOI: https://doi.org/10.1007/978-0-387-09663-6_20
Publisher Name: Springer, New York, NY
Print ISBN: 978-0-387-09662-9
Online ISBN: 978-0-387-09663-6
eBook Packages: EngineeringEngineering (R0)